Schema Markup Validation: Complete Guide & Tools 2026
Did you know that websites with properly validated schema markup are 73% more likely to appear in rich results according to Google’s latest data? However, despite its importance, over 60% of websites have schema markup validation errors that prevent them from achieving enhanced search visibility. Schema markup validation is the critical process of verifying that your structured data is correctly formatted, error-free, and optimized for search engines to understand and display your content in rich results.
In this comprehensive guide, you’ll discover everything you need to know about validating schema markup effectively in 2026. We’ll cover the latest validation tools, testing methods, common errors to avoid, and proven strategies to ensure your structured data delivers maximum SEO impact. Whether you’re a beginner or experienced developer, this guide will help you master schema markup validation and unlock the full potential of your website’s search performance.
Table of Contents
- Understanding Schema Markup Validation
- Essential Schema Markup Validation Tools
- Google Schema Validation Tools
- Step-by-Step Validation Process
- Common Schema Markup Validation Errors
- Advanced Validation Techniques
- Monitoring and Optimization Strategies
- Frequently Asked Questions
- Conclusion
Understanding Schema Markup Validation
Schema markup validation is the systematic process of checking structured data to ensure it follows schema.org standards and search engine requirements. This validation confirms that your markup is syntactically correct, semantically appropriate, and capable of generating rich results in search engine results pages (SERPs).
Why Schema Markup Validation Matters
Search engines process billions of web pages daily, and only properly validated schema markup gets recognized and utilized. When your structured data passes validation, it becomes eligible for rich results, including star ratings, product prices, FAQ snippets, and enhanced business listings. Moreover, invalid schema markup can actually harm your SEO performance by confusing search engine crawlers.
According to recent studies, validated schema markup can increase click-through rates by up to 30% and improve search visibility significantly. The validation process ensures that your structured data meets current standards and remains compatible with evolving search engine algorithms.
Types of Schema Markup Validation
There are several validation approaches to consider:
- Syntax Validation: Checks for proper JSON-LD, Microdata, or RDFa formatting
- Semantic Validation: Verifies that schema types and properties are used correctly
- Search Engine Validation: Tests compatibility with specific search engine requirements
- Rich Results Validation: Confirms eligibility for enhanced SERP features
Essential Schema Markup Validation Tools
Selecting the right schema markup validator is crucial for maintaining accurate structured data. Different tools offer unique features and validation capabilities, making it important to understand which tools work best for specific scenarios.
Schema.org Markup Validator
The official Schema.org Markup Validator serves as the primary validation tool for all schema.org markup types. This comprehensive schema markup testing tool provides detailed feedback on syntax errors, missing properties, and compatibility issues across different schema types.
The Schema.org validator is considered the gold standard for generic schema validation, offering the most comprehensive coverage of schema.org vocabulary without search engine-specific restrictions.
Key features of the Schema.org validator include:
- Support for JSON-LD, Microdata, and RDFa formats
- Real-time validation feedback
- Detailed error reporting with specific line references
- No Google-specific validation limitations
Third-Party Schema Markup Validators
Several professional schema markup checker tools offer additional features beyond basic validation. These tools often provide batch processing, monitoring capabilities, and detailed analytics about your schema implementation.
Popular third-party validators include Screaming Frog’s schema analyzer, SEMrush’s structured data checker, and various schema markup validator extensions for browsers. These tools excel at large-scale validation projects and ongoing monitoring requirements.
Google Schema Validation Tools
Google provides specialized tools for validating schema markup with a focus on rich results eligibility. Understanding how to use these Google schema validator tools effectively is essential for maximizing your search performance.
Rich Results Test
The Rich Results Test specifically validates schema markup for Google’s rich results features. This tool goes beyond basic validation to determine whether your structured data qualifies for enhanced SERP displays like product snippets, recipe cards, and event listings.
To use the Rich Results Test effectively:
- Navigate to Google’s Rich Results Test tool
- Enter your URL or paste your HTML code directly
- Review the validation results and rich results preview
- Address any errors or warnings identified by the tool
Structured Data Testing Tool Evolution
Google’s structured data testing tool has evolved significantly, with the Rich Results Test replacing the legacy Structured Data Testing Tool for most use cases. However, the original tool remains valuable for comprehensive schema markup validation beyond rich results eligibility.
The key differences between these tools include:
| Feature | Rich Results Test | Legacy Testing Tool |
|---|---|---|
| Rich Results Preview | Yes | No |
| All Schema Types | Limited | Yes |
| Google-specific Validation | Yes | Yes |
| Mobile Testing | Yes | Limited |
Google Search Console Integration
Google Search Console provides ongoing schema markup validation through its Enhancement reports. These reports show how Google interprets your structured data in real-world crawling scenarios, offering insights that standalone validators cannot provide.
The Enhancement reports track various schema markup types including products, recipes, FAQs, and local business information. Regular monitoring of these reports helps identify validation issues that may only appear during actual crawling and indexing processes.
Step-by-Step Schema Markup Validation Process
Implementing a systematic approach to schema markup validation ensures comprehensive coverage and consistent results. This proven methodology helps identify and resolve validation issues efficiently while maintaining high-quality structured data implementation.
Pre-Validation Preparation
Before beginning the validation process, gather all necessary information about your schema implementation. Document the schema markup types you’re using, identify critical pages that require validation, and prepare test URLs or code snippets for validation tools.
Essential preparation steps include:
- Creating an inventory of all schema markup implementations
- Identifying priority pages for validation testing
- Documenting expected rich results for each schema type
- Preparing both live URLs and staging environment URLs for testing
Initial Validation Testing
Start your validation process with the Schema.org Markup Validator to establish a baseline assessment. This initial test reveals fundamental syntax errors and structural issues that must be addressed before proceeding to search engine-specific validation.
During initial testing, focus on:
- Syntax accuracy and proper formatting
- Required properties for each schema type
- Proper nesting and relationship structures
- Data type consistency and value formats
Search Engine-Specific Validation
After resolving basic validation issues, proceed to test your schema markup with Google’s Rich Results Test and other search engine validation tools. This step determines whether your structured data qualifies for enhanced search features and identifies search engine-specific requirements.
Pay particular attention to warnings and suggestions provided by these tools, as they often indicate optimization opportunities that can improve your rich results eligibility and performance.
Common Schema Markup Validation Errors
Understanding frequent schema markup validation errors helps prevent common mistakes and speeds up the debugging process. These errors range from simple syntax issues to complex semantic problems that can significantly impact your structured data effectiveness.
Syntax and Formatting Errors
Syntax errors represent the most common category of schema markup validation failures. These issues typically stem from incorrect JSON-LD formatting, missing commas, improper quotation marks, or malformed data structures.
Common syntax errors include:
- Missing Commas: Forgetting commas between properties or array elements
- Incorrect Quotation Marks: Using single quotes instead of double quotes in JSON-LD
- Malformed URLs: Including invalid characters or incomplete URL structures
- Data Type Mismatches: Using strings where numbers are expected or vice versa
In my experience working with hundreds of schema implementations, syntax errors account for approximately 40% of all validation failures, but they’re also the easiest to fix with proper attention to detail.
Missing Required Properties
Each schema type has specific required properties that must be present for valid implementation. Missing these essential properties results in validation errors and can prevent rich results from appearing in search results.
For example, Product schema requires name, image, and offers properties, while LocalBusiness schema must include name, address, and telephone information. Regularly consulting the schema.org documentation helps ensure all required properties are included in your implementations.
Semantic and Logic Errors
Semantic errors occur when schema markup is syntactically correct but semantically inappropriate or illogical. These errors can be particularly challenging to identify because they don’t always trigger obvious validation warnings.
Examples of semantic errors include:
- Using inappropriate schema types for your content
- Providing contradictory information across related properties
- Including properties that don’t make sense for your schema context
- Mixing schema types inappropriately without proper relationships
Advanced Validation Techniques
Professional schema markup validation requires advanced techniques that go beyond basic tool usage. These methods help ensure comprehensive validation coverage and maintain high-quality structured data implementations at scale.
Automated Validation Workflows
Implementing automated schema markup validation workflows saves time and ensures consistent quality across large websites. These systems can validate schema markup during development, staging, and production phases, catching errors before they impact search performance.
Advanced automation approaches include:
- CI/CD pipeline integration for schema validation
- Scheduled validation monitoring for live websites
- Batch validation processing for large page sets
- Custom validation rules for organization-specific requirements
Multi-Tool Validation Strategy
Relying on a single validation tool can miss certain types of errors or optimization opportunities. A comprehensive multi-tool approach combines different validators to achieve thorough coverage and identify the full range of potential issues.
An effective multi-tool strategy typically includes:
- Schema.org Markup Validator for comprehensive schema.org compliance
- Google Rich Results Test for rich results eligibility
- Third-party tools for additional insights and monitoring
- Custom validation scripts for specific business requirements
Schema Markup Validator Extensions
Browser-based schema markup validator extensions provide convenient real-time validation during development and testing. These tools offer immediate feedback while browsing websites and can significantly speed up the development and debugging process.
Popular validator extensions offer features like automatic schema detection, real-time validation feedback, and quick access to testing tools without leaving your browser environment.
Monitoring and Optimization Strategies
Successful schema markup validation extends beyond initial implementation to include ongoing monitoring and continuous optimization. This proactive approach ensures sustained performance and adaptation to evolving search engine requirements.
Ongoing Validation Monitoring
Regular monitoring helps identify validation issues that may develop over time due to content changes, template updates, or evolving search engine requirements. Establishing a systematic monitoring schedule prevents small issues from becoming major problems.
Effective monitoring strategies include:
- Weekly validation checks for critical pages
- Monthly comprehensive site audits
- Alert systems for new validation errors
- Performance tracking for rich results appearance
Performance Impact Analysis
Measuring the impact of validated schema markup on search performance helps demonstrate ROI and identify optimization opportunities. This analysis should connect validation improvements to measurable search performance metrics.
According to recent industry data, websites that maintain consistently validated schema markup see 25% higher rich results appearance rates compared to sites with intermittent validation issues.
Key performance metrics to track include:
- Rich results impression and click-through rates
- Search visibility for target keywords
- Schema markup coverage across important pages
- Validation error rates and resolution times
Future-Proofing Your Schema Implementation
Schema markup standards and search engine requirements continue evolving, making future-proofing strategies essential for long-term success. Staying informed about updates and maintaining flexible implementations helps ensure continued validation success.
Future-proofing approaches include following schema.org updates, monitoring search engine announcements, participating in structured data communities, and maintaining documentation for your schema implementations.
Frequently Asked Questions
How do I know if my schema markup is working?
You can determine if your schema markup is working by using validation tools like Google’s Rich Results Test and the Schema.org Markup Validator, monitoring Google Search Console’s Enhancement reports for structured data performance, and checking if your pages appear with rich results in search results. Additionally, you should verify that validation tools show no critical errors and that your structured data appears correctly when parsed by testing tools.
How to validate the schema?
To validate schema markup, start by using the Schema.org Markup Validator to check for basic syntax and semantic errors, then test with Google’s Rich Results Test to verify rich results eligibility, and finally monitor ongoing performance through Google Search Console. The validation process involves entering your URL or pasting code directly into validation tools, reviewing all error messages and warnings, and making necessary corrections before retesting to confirm successful validation.
How to optimize schema markup?
Optimize schema markup by ensuring all required properties are included, using the most specific schema types available for your content, maintaining consistent data across your website, and regularly updating structured data to reflect content changes. Additionally, focus on including recommended properties that enhance rich results eligibility, avoid unnecessary or irrelevant schema properties, and implement proper relationships between different schema types when appropriate.
What are the tools for schema validation?
The primary tools for schema validation include the Schema.org Markup Validator for comprehensive schema.org compliance testing, Google’s Rich Results Test for rich results eligibility verification, Google Search Console for ongoing monitoring and performance tracking, and various third-party tools like Screaming Frog, SEMrush, and browser extensions. Each tool offers unique features, with some focusing on syntax validation while others emphasize search engine compatibility and rich results optimization.
What is the difference between schema markup generator and validator tools?
A schema markup generator helps create structured data code from scratch by providing templates and guided inputs for different schema types, while a schema markup validator tests existing code for errors and compliance. Generators are useful for initial implementation, whereas validators are essential for ongoing quality assurance and error detection. Most comprehensive schema workflows involve using generators for creation followed by validators for verification and optimization.
Conclusion
Schema markup validation represents a critical component of modern SEO strategy that directly impacts your website’s search visibility and rich results performance. Throughout this comprehensive guide, we’ve explored the essential tools, techniques, and best practices that ensure your structured data meets current standards and delivers maximum SEO value.
The key takeaways for successful schema markup validation include implementing a multi-tool validation approach using both Schema.org and Google validators, establishing systematic workflows that catch errors early in the development process, and maintaining ongoing monitoring to address issues promptly. Additionally, understanding common validation errors helps prevent frequent mistakes, while advanced techniques enable scalable validation for larger websites.
Furthermore, the landscape of structured data continues evolving, making continuous learning and adaptation essential for sustained success. Regular validation monitoring, performance analysis, and staying updated with schema.org developments ensure your implementations remain effective and compliant with changing search engine requirements.
As we move forward in 2026, schema markup validation will become even more critical as search engines become more sophisticated in their structured data requirements and rich results offerings expand. By implementing the strategies and techniques outlined in this guide, you’ll be well-positioned to maximize your website’s search performance through properly validated schema markup.
Start implementing these schema markup validation strategies today to unlock the full potential of your website’s structured data and achieve enhanced search visibility that drives meaningful business results.
